> > The point is that we can simply do:
> >
> > #define __BITS_PER_LONG (__SIZEOF_LONG__ << 3)
> >
> > ... and it will always be consistent.
>
> We have discussed this before, but decided it was too early to
> assume that userspace compilers are recent enough for that.
> According to godbolt.org, gcc-4.1 lacks __SIZEOF_LONG__ while
> gcc-4.4 has it, as do all versions of clang. Not sure what other
> compilers one may encounter using Linux kernel headers.

For instance MSVC doesn't define __SIZEOF_LONG__ or __x86_64__.
Unlikely to be used, but...

So you can use __SIZEOF_LONG__ if it is defined, if not hunt for
something else (possible just fixed in the installed headers).
But in the latter case (at least) a compile-time check that the
value is correct makes sense.
And that can be done portably - probable with a negative array size.
